About D. Sokol

D. Sokol is a scholar working on Molecular Biology, Food Science, Immunology, Infectious Diseases and Surgery, having authored 5 papers that have together received 985 indexed citations. Recurring topics across this work include Probiotics and Fermented Foods (3 papers), Gut microbiota and health (3 papers), Asthma and respiratory diseases (1 paper), Galectins and Cancer Biology (1 paper), Celiac Disease Research and Management (1 paper), IL-33, ST2, and ILC Pathways (1 paper), Escherichia coli research studies (1 paper) and Clostridium difficile and Clostridium perfringens research (1 paper). The work is most often cited by research in Gastroenterology (125 citations), Periodontics (51 citations), Food Science (195 citations), Biological Psychiatry (26 citations) and Infectious Diseases (169 citations). D. Sokol has collaborated with scholars based in Czechia, Poland and Myanmar. Frequent co-authors include P Roßmann, Tomáš Hudcovic, Helena Tlaskalová‐Hogenová, Ludmila Tučková, Alena Kokešová, Jiřina Bártová, R. Lodinová‐Žádníková, Renáta Štëpánková, Z Řeháková and J Šinkora. Their work appears in journals such as International Archives of Allergy and Immunology, Immunology Letters, Clinical & Experimental Immunology and Folia Microbiologica.
